Description
Unicredit Banka Slovenija has expanded its network in Slovenia and by the end January 2009 has increased its workforce by 90 employees.
Unicredit Banka Slovenija is a Slovenian subsidiary of Italian based Unicredit Bank. In 2008, the bank's network in Slovenia expanded and, as a consequence, the number of employees increased from 444 to 534 by the end of January 2009, i.e. by 90 people.
